Weekly PEM meeting
- 2020/03/13(Fri) 16:00-(JST)
- Regular meeting (Japanese)
Web meeting with Zoom2 (Zoom2)
Agenda
General issue
- Interferometer status
- Two weeks observation was finished
- Maximum 594kpc BNS detection range
- Maximum Lock duration is over 10h
- 3/10 - commissioning break started
- Noise projection
- Hammering test (Sat. and Sun. morning time)
